Contango Silver and Gold Reports Q1 2026 Results, Operational Transition Underway
Contango Silver and Gold reported Q1 2026 results, highlighting operational challenges at Manh Choh due to winter conditions but expecting higher production ahead.

Contango Silver and Gold Inc. (NYSE American: CTGO) (TSX: CTGO) filed its Form 10-Q for the quarter ended March 31, 2026, revealing a period of operational transition and strategic growth. The company reported that harsh winter conditions and operational challenges impacted throughput and costs at its Manh Choh project in Alaska during Q1. However, management expressed optimism about entering a high-production phase, with expectations of increased ore tons processed and higher ore grade in the coming quarters.
The Manh Choh project, a key asset for Contango, faced typical Alaskan winter headwinds that constrained mining and processing activities. Despite these setbacks, the company's CEO, Rick Van Nieuwenhuyse, emphasized that the first quarter was a period of significant operational transition and strategic growth.
